What to look for in a gas engineer

Before hiring a gas engineer, consider the following:

  • Qualifications: Ensure they have NVQ Level 2, City & Guilds, and are Gas Safe registered.
  • Insurance: Public liability insurance should be at least Ā£1 million.
  • Reviews: Check for consistent positive feedback on reliability and quality.
  • Local knowledge: Familiarity with issues like coastal salt damage and properties in conservation areas.

Do I need planning permission for a new boiler installation in Whitley Bay?
In most cases, planning permission is not required for a boiler installation, but listed buildings or conservation areas in Whitley Bay may have specific restrictions.

Are gas engineers in Whitley Bay certified by the Gas Safe Register?
Yes, all practising gas engineers in Whitley Bay must be certified by the Gas Safe Register to legally carry out gas work.
